Transaction 64bc7ea14bf47c5fe571e8b19cf930ab2b234eb78ded739983d54c4d6bd9e86b

1 Input
2 Outputs
  • 64bc7ea14bf47c5fe571e8b19cf930ab2b234eb78ded739983d54c4d6bd9e86b:0
  • value  265074627
    address  3AgWp7aVZP2qRJacks4t9PDD88LdPDGrCc
  • 64bc7ea14bf47c5fe571e8b19cf930ab2b234eb78ded739983d54c4d6bd9e86b:1
  • value  1000000
    address  3EEEBdxPKaEtw56GxMX6sWkz6cG42PvPE1